On August 2, 2008 the Alaska SeaLife Center will host its 10th annual “Wildlife Rescue Run,” a five-kilometer race that helps raise money for the Center’s rehabilitation department. The event attracts approximately 150 participants walking or running the course, along with families whose children participate in an accompanying “Junior Rescue Rally.”

The Alaska SeaLife Center is the only permanent facility in Alaska licensed to rescue and rehabilitate marine mammals and birds. The rehabilitation program depends on financial support from the community in its continuing efforts to treat these animals, and all sponsorships and entry fees will benefit Wildlife Rescue.
